﻿.ACTS_Services_topNavItem td
{
	color: #666666;
	border: none;
	border-right: 1px #ed2939 solid;
	border-top: 1px #ed2939 solid;
	font-size: 12px;
	height: 47px;
	vertical-align: bottom;
}
.ACTS_Services_topNavItem a
{
	color: #666666;
	display: block;
	width: 89px;
	margin: 0 16px;
}
.ACTS_Services_topNavSelected a
{
	color: #ed2939;
}
.ACTS_Services_topNavHover a
{
	color:#ed2939;
}
#Content_Zone .Isoleted_TD{
	/*background-color:#fdeed0;*/
}

#Content_Zone h1, #Content_Zone h2, #Content_Zone h3, #Content_Zone h4, #Content_Zone h5,
.content h1, .content h2, .content h3, .content h4, .content h5 {
	color:#ed2939;
}

#Content_Zone li a {
	text-decoration:none;
	color:#ed2939 !important;
}

#Content_Zone li a:active:hover:link:visited{
	color:#ed2939 !important;
}
.content p a,
#Content_Zone p a {
	color:#ed2939 !important;
}
#Content_Zone p a:active:hover:link:visited,
#Content_Zone p a:active:hover:link:visited {
	color:#ed2939 !important;
	text-decoration:none;
}

/**/
.leftNav1, .leftNav2, .leftNav3,
.leftNav1 a, .leftNav2 a, .leftNav3 a {
	color:#666666;
	font-style:normal;
	font-size: 11px !important;
	font-family:Arial, Helvetica, sans-serif;	
	text-decoration: none;
	font-weight: normal;
	line-height: 16px;
}
.leftNavHover,
.leftNavSelected {
	background-color: transparent;
	border: none;
	margin: 0 0 1em 0;
	padding: 0;
	margin: 0
}
.leftNavSelected  {
	color: #ed2939 !important;
}
.leftNav {
	background-color: transparent;
	border: none;
	margin: 0 0 1em 0;
	line-height: 16px;
}
#MSOZoneCell_WebPartWPQ3,
#WebPartWPQ2 {
	
	padding: 0 28px 0 22px;
}
/* sitemap hack */
.toc-layout-main {
	margin-left: -10px;
}
